Nellie's Puerto Rican Restaurant is a family-owned eatery located in the heart of Chicago's vibrant Puerto Rican community. Since its opening in March 2006, Nellie's has earned a reputation as one of "Chicago's Best" by offering a unique blend of traditional Puerto Rican cuisine, American breakfast favorites, and signature dishes like their famous 'avena de coco' (coconut oatmeal) and weekend buffet. Prepared by a talented cooking staff using the highest quality ingredients, each dish is served with a warm smile. Nellie's is not just a restaurant, it's an unforgettable dining experience.
